Fastmail
Privacy-focused business email, calendar and contacts with custom domains and shared addresses — Business Basic from $3/user/month annual; adjacent to business communications, not a phone system.
Best for
- • Small teams that want private, independent business email on their own domain
- • Owner-operators who need shared support@ addresses and shared calendars cheaply
- • Buyers who need an email retention archive for legal compliance (Professional)
Starting from $3.00/user/mo

Ooma
SMB VoIP (Ooma Office) — Essentials from $19.95/user/mo monthly; Pro $24.95; Pro Plus $29.95 — no annual lock-in.
Best for
- • Small businesses that want transparent monthly VoIP without annual contracts
- • Teams under ~15 seats needing receptionist, ring groups and optional queues
- • Buyers who prefer published Office seat floors over quote-only UCaaS
Starting from $19.95/user/mo
